Introduction

This comprehensive spare parts lineup is precision-engineered exclusively for the HTD-250/CR Drillmec top drive system, a heavy-duty top drive drilling unit widely deployed in onshore exploration rigs, offshore workover platforms, and directional drilling operations. Target users include drilling rig maintenance supervisors, top drive service technicians, rig asset procurement specialists, and drilling operations managers who prioritize zero unplanned downtime, strict compliance with API 8C and API 7K standards, and seamless annual preventive maintenance execution.

Functional Description

These components support all core systems of the HTD-250/CR top drive, with key functions including:

  • Flushing Pipe Assembly: Flushing pipes, packing devices, and sealing kits prevent mud leakage and maintain fluid circulation during drilling operations.
  • Brake & Limiter Systems: Brake pistons, discs, shear pins, and self-locking nuts ensure reliable torque holding and emergency stop functionality.
  • Hydraulic Vise & Handling Components: Jaws, guides, bushings, and springs deliver secure pipe gripping and precise tubular handling.
  • Hydraulic & Filtration Systems: Proportional valves, filters, and pressure switches regulate hydraulic flow and maintain fluid cleanliness for consistent performance.
  • Swivel & Hook Assemblies: Bearings, pads, and sensors ensure smooth rotation and safe load handling for drilling tubulars.

Maintenance & Service Recommendations

  1. Complete full annual maintenance every 12 months or 8,000 drilling hours, replacing all wear components and seals in this kit to prevent failures.
  2. Lubricate bearings, bushings, and lubrication nipples every 50 operating hours with high-temperature drilling grease to reduce friction.
  3. Inspect hydraulic filters monthly, replacing clogged filters immediately to protect hydraulic pumps and valves.
  4. Check shear pins and brake components quarterly for wear or damage, replacing worn parts to maintain safe braking performance.
  5. Calibrate pressure switches and sensors annually to ensure accurate system monitoring and compliance with operational parameters.
  6. Store spare parts in a dry, dust-controlled environment to prevent seal hardening, corrosion, and component degradation.

On-Site Fault Repair Cases (HTD-250/CR Drillmec Top Drive)

Case 1: Hydraulic Vise Gripping Failure

The HTD-250/CR top drive hydraulic vise failed to securely grip drilling tubulars, causing slippage during makeup. Inspection revealed worn jaws (19014296) and damaged guide bushings. Replacing the vise jaws and bushings from this maintenance kit restored secure gripping, resuming drilling operations within 2 hours.

Case 2: Flushing Pipe Mud Leakage

A severe mud leak developed at the flushing pipe assembly during drilling, traced to deteriorated packing devices (RI01895132-07) and O-rings. Installing new packing sets and sealing components eliminated leaks, restoring proper mud circulation and pressure control.

Case 3: Top Drive Brake Malfunction

The top drive brake system failed to hold torque, creating a safety hazard during tubular handling. Diagnostics showed worn brake pistons (18112837) and damaged brake discs. Replacing these brake components with OEM-matched parts restored full braking functionality and compliance with rig safety standards.
